Solution Overview

Problem

Conventional estate handling techniques are inefficient, time-consuming, and frustrating for family members dealing with the estates of deceased individuals, lacking a secure and efficient system for collecting and accessing personal and financial information.

Innovation Solution

A computer-implemented method and system utilizing a chatbot or digital assistant to securely store personal and financial information, allowing trusted individuals to access it through a simulated conversation with a chatbot avatar, facilitating estate handling and insurance claim processing.

AI summary

A computer-implement method and computer system may be configured to facilitate insurance claim processing and estate handling. An audible or visible chatbot avator or dopplegänger may lead a trustee, beneficiary, or family member through the estate of an impaired or deceased user. A computer system may have been provided with, or gather, sample voice and visual recordings associated with a user that are used to build the chatbot avatar that simulates the user audibly and/or visually. The computer system may have previously prompted the user for necessary items to properly handle their estate, such as information related to financial accounts, loans, insurance policies, etc. and user names and passwords to various electronic accounts.
